you said you had a teardrop right?
689 - .690 is the size of your barrel then
All stars are .682-.685
I would recommend Marbalizers for it personally, they are .686-.688
Heres a Complete Chart:

Paintball Sizes

Paint Brand Bore Description Barrel Bore Size Range
RPS Premium Medium
.689 - .691
RPS Premium Gold Medium .689 - .691
RPS Marbalizer Small .686 - .688
RPS All-Star Very small .682 - .685
RPS BigBall Medium to small .688 - .690
Proball Small .686 - .688
Proball Lite Small to medium .687 - .689
Proball Devil Small .686 - .688
Proball Platinum Small .686 - .688
Zap Select Medium .689 - .691
Zap Classic Medium .689 - .691
Zap Advantage Medium to small .688 - .690
Zap ProSeries Medium to small .688 - .690
Zap ProSport Medium .689 - .691
Brass Eagle, old style Large .692+
Brass Eagle Top Brass Medium .689 - .691
Nelson Challenger Large .692+
Paintball Mania First Choice Large .692+
PowerBall Medium .689 - .691
Diablo Inferno Small .686 - .688
Diablo Blaze Medium to Small .688 - .690
Diablo HellFire Very small .682 - .685
PMI Paintballs Medium .689 - .691
